The baths in the Mývatn area are more accessible from Akureyri, known as the capital of northern Iceland, taking just an hour and fifteen minutes in the car.

Mývatn Nature Baths includes an artificial lagoon and pool of geothermally heated water and was opened for visitors in 2004 as a spa and relaxation center. However, its hot water source has been used by locals for bathing and washing purposes for a very long time. The water for the lagoon comes from the borehole in Bjarnarflag, belonging to ...

Oct 19, 2023 · Either way, you will pass through the northern region of Iceland, home to Mývatn Nature Baths! Mývatn Nature Baths is a man-made facility that has been in operation since June 2004. The water supply for the lagoon comes from the nearby National Power Company’s bore hole located in Bjarnarflag, and is drawn from a depth of up to 2500 meters. The Basics. With water bubbling between 96.8°F (36°C) and 102.2°F (39°C) and an idyllic backdrop of looming volcanoes and picturesque Lake Myvatn, visiting the baths is the perfect way to soothe tired limbs after a day spent exploring the surrounding volcano- and glacier-laced landscape. Myvatn Nature Bath, or Jarðböðin, is a geothermal resort often compared to the “Blue Lagoon” on the Reykjanes Peninsula. This is the perfect place to rest your weary bones after a good day of hiking in Myvatn. Jarðböðin is open every day of the year until midnight in summer and 8PM in winter. Witness the …

The characteristics of the water are unique in many ways. It contains a large amount of minerals, is alkaline and well suited for bathing.The Myvatn Nature Baths are located in Jardbadsholar, in an area characterised by its high levels of geothermal activity.The man-made lagoon is filled from steaming …

However, the Myvatn Nature Baths were a suitable substitute, and might even be better than the Blue Lagoon. Unlike the Blue Lagoon, you don’t need to book your visit in advance. An adult ticket is 5700 ISK, and there are other prices for teenagers and seniors, too.
